    Resolved [RESOLVED] [2008] Can't change Panel visibility?

    Yo!

    I've created a class, clsWizardStep, to hold the data for the 'steps' for my 'application configuration wizard' and one of the properties of this class is simply to hold which Panel will be visible during the defined step.

    The steps are stored in a List(Of clsWizardStep). When I try to set the panel visible, the change in boolean value for the property doesn't take effect.

    So culling off any code I can't see being necessary, here's what I've got. Sorry to make this so long, at least I've remembered to include some code!

    My class...

    vb.net Code:
    1. Public Class clsWizardStep
    2.  
    3.     Private _Title As String
    4.     Private _Description As String
    5.     Private _Panel As Panel
    6.     Private _ButtonText_Prev As String
    7.     Private _ButtonText_Next As String
    8.  
    9.     Public Property Title() As String
    10.         Get
    11.             Return _Title
    12.         End Get
    13.         Set(ByVal value As String)
    14.             _Title = value
    15.         End Set
    16.     End Property
    17.  
    18.     Public Property Description() As String
    19.         Get
    20.             Return _Description
    21.         End Get
    22.         Set(ByVal value As String)
    23.             _Description = value
    24.         End Set
    25.     End Property
    26.  
    27.     Public Property Panel() As Panel
    28.         Get
    29.             Return _Panel
    30.         End Get
    31.         Set(ByVal value As Panel)
    32.             _Panel = value
    33.         End Set
    34.     End Property
    35.  
    36.     Public Property ButtonText_Prev() As String
    37.         Get
    38.             Return _ButtonText_Prev
    39.         End Get
    40.         Set(ByVal value As String)
    41.             _ButtonText_Prev = value
    42.         End Set
    43.     End Property
    44.  
    45.     Public Property ButtonText_Next() As String
    46.         Get
    47.             Return _ButtonText_Next
    48.         End Get
    49.         Set(ByVal value As String)
    50.             _ButtonText_Next = value
    51.         End Set
    52.     End Property
    53.  
    54. End Class

    Function to add an item to the list:

    vb.net Code:
    1. Public Sub WizardSteps_AddStep(ByVal lstList As List(Of clsWizardStep), ByVal strTitle As String, ByVal strDescription As String, ByVal pnlPanel As Panel, ByVal strButtonText_Prev As String, ByVal strButtonText_Next As String)
    2.  
    3.         Dim thisStep As New clsWizardStep
    4.         thisStep.Title = strTitle
    5.         thisStep.Description = strDescription
    6.         thisStep.Panel = pnlPanel
    7.         thisStep.ButtonText_Prev = strButtonText_Prev
    8.         thisStep.ButtonText_Next = strButtonText_Next
    9.  
    10.         lstList.Add(thisStep)
    11.  
    12.     End Sub

    And in this function, I try to change the Visible property of the panel:

    vb.net Code:
    1. Private Sub Wizard_Next() Handles btnNext.Click
    2.  
    3.         If intCurrentPosition < (lstWizardSteps.Count - 1) Then
    4.  
    5.             intCurrentPosition += 1
    6.  
    7.             lblHeader.Text = l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).Title
    8.             lblStepDescription.Text = l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).Description
    9.             btnPrev.Text = l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).ButtonText_Prev
    10.             btnNext.Text = l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).ButtonText_Next
    11.  
    12.             Dim thisPanel As Panel
    13.             thisPanel = l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).Panel
    14.             thisPanel.Visible = True
    15.  
    16.             Debug.WriteLine(thisPanel.Visible)
    17.  
    18.         Else
    19.             'Perform a Save?
    20.             MessageBox.Show("This is where you save your settings...")
    21.             Me.Close()
    22.         End If
    23.  
    24.     End Sub

    The list works fine, the items are created. The properties for the class are set. The panels exist.

    I've tried a few different methods for setting the property, none have worked.
    I.e.
    vb.net Code:
    1. Dim thisPanel As Panel
    2.             thisPanel = DirectCast(l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).Panel, Panel)
    3.             thisPanel.Visible = True
    4.  
    5. 'or
    6.  
    7.             Dim thisPanel As New Panel
    8.             thisPanel = l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).Panel
    9.             thisPanel.Visible = True
    10.  
    11. 'or
    12.  
    13. lstWizardSteps(intCurrentPosition).Panel.Visible = True

    Since then, I have tried setting Modifiers properties of the panels to "Public" and that also didn't make any difference. I also tried adding a Sub to the class to change the property but assuming I did that correctly, it also didn't work. Arrgghh!

    Clearly I'm missing something here, tried for an hour to nut this out to no avail. Any help peoples? Hope so!
